What is the difference between monitoring and observability? Monitoring deals with "known unknowns" while observability deals with "unknown unknowns." Observability is surveying your environment to avoid the above-mentioned anomalies and predicting changes, if any.

The role of infrastructure monitoring tools
An infrastructure monitoring tool is a software solution that provides real-time visibility into an organisation’s IT estate, including servers, storage, networks, and applications. By collecting and analysing performance metrics, these tools help IT teams detect potential issues before they impact operations. Leading solutions include ManageEngine OpManager, LogicMonitor, SolarWinds, Dynatrace, and Paessler, each offering capabilities to enhance visibility and optimise resource utilisation.
Why organisations need these tools
Without proper monitoring, IT teams often operate in the dark, leading to:
- Unexpected costs: Poor visibility into licensing, resource usage, and capacity planning results in overspending.
- Performance bottlenecks: IT teams reactively firefight performance issues instead of preventing them.
- Security risks: A lack of real-time observability increases the chances of undetected vulnerabilities.
- Compliance challenges: Meeting regulatory requirements becomes difficult without accurate reporting and monitoring.
Key benefits
Implementing an infrastructure monitoring tool delivers several critical advantages:
- Comprehensive visibility: Gain a clear understanding of the entire IT estate, including on-premises and cloud assets.
- Improved performance & uptime: Detect and address performance bottlenecks before they escalate into outages.
- Optimised resource utilisation: Identify redundant or underused resources to reduce waste and lower costs.
- Proactive maintenance: Shift from reactive firefighting to proactive IT management, minimising unplanned downtime.
- Enhanced reporting & compliance: Generate detailed reports to support audits and strategic decision-making.
- Simplified IT management: Consolidate monitoring tasks across diverse systems within a single interface.
Implementing & optimising infrastructure monitoring
To successfully implement and maintain an infrastructure monitoring tool:
- Assess needs & select tools: Define key performance indicators (KPIs), integration requirements, and evaluate scalable solutions.
- Deploy & configure: Install the tool, set monitoring thresholds, and integrate with IT workflows.
- Train IT staff & establish best practices: Ensure teams are equipped to use the tool effectively, change practices and process, enable your teams and schedule periodic reviews.
- Continuously improve & optimise: Implementing a tool is achievable for most, continuously adjusting operations are difficult i.e. improving operations, regularly refining configurations, conducting audits, engaging vendors for updates, and foster knowledge sharing among IT teams.
